Customize the Sage Accpac desktop to include your own icons

Customize Sage Accpac Icons by making your own folder, or add a shortcut to Excel

You can customize the Sage Accpac desktop to suit your needs. Add new folders and items to your desktop, and rearrange existing objects. For example, you could create a new folder that contains only the applications, macros, and reports you use regularly. You could also create a startup folder that starts all applications in the folder at sign-on. Any object you add will be added to the currently-selected folder.

For example, you could add two personal folders to your desktop:

  • Put icons for all the Sage Accpac tasks you use into a folder called “My Tasks” such as Excel, EFT, Customized Crystal Reports, etc.

  • Put the icons for objects that you want started automatically when you start Sage Accpac into a folder called “Startup.”

To add new objects to the desktop

  1. Choose New from the Object menu, and then choose the type of object you are adding from the sub-menu.

  2. Type a title for the object you are adding. The title appears on the Sage Accpac desktop with the object’s icon. The icon for new macros and programs will also appear on the Sage Accpac Web desktop if you choose that option on the second screen.

  3. Choose Change Icon to select a different icon for the object.

  4. Select the All Users option so this new object will appear on the Sage Accpac desktops of all the users who open the database. (Once the object has been added to the desktop, you cannot change the All Users option.)

  5. If you are adding a folder, click Finish to add the folder to the desktop.

Reversing Cheques is a Breeze

... no really... Reversing Cheques in Sage Accpac is a Breeze...

For those of us who have ever had to reverse a cheque in Sage Accpac Plus for DOS, we really appreciate the Bank Services module that is built into the System Manager!  There is a function in the Bank Services that allows either Payroll or Accounts Payable cheques to be easily reversed.  This function reverses the cheque and can be run at anytime during the month, including while you perform a bank reconciliation.

If you are reversing a check, and you can't find it in the list, make sure that you have posted all open batches in the subledger that pertain to the period in question.  If system security is turned on, you must be assigned to a user group authorized to reverse checks.  When the reversals are posted, the bank account balance is updated.   When you reverse a vendor payment, Bank Services sends the information back to the originating ledger so the invoice that the check was intended to pay is reinstated.

To reverse a check:

  1. Choose the bank on which the check was written.
  2. Choose Direct Mode or Select Mode for selecting checks.

If you issue a lot of checks, Direct Mode is faster. If you issue relatively few checks, use Select Mode.

Using Direct Mode lets you specify one or more checks to reverse, or lets you choose individual checks from the Finder.

  • Specify the number of the check (or check number range) in the From and To Check fields.   OR

 Or

  • Click in the columnar section of the window, and press the Insert key. Then type a check number or press the Finder button to search for the check you want to reverse.

Using Select Mode lets you scroll through a list of checks and select the ones to reverse.

  • Double-click the check you want to reverse.
  1. Select or specify the check to reverse, then change the reconciliation status to Reversed.    If you use Direct Mode, specifying the check sets the status to Reversed. To change it back to Outstanding, choose Select mode, then change the status.   The program updates the Status Change Date with the Windows system date.
  2. Tab or scroll to the Reversal Description column and enter the reason for the reversal.
  3. Reverse more checks, if necessary.
  4. Click Post when you are finished.
